Woman After God's Own Heart Bible Study Series

Becoming a Woman of Beauty and Strength: Esther

Rate this book
Esther was in the right place at the right time. When God's guiding hand made her queen over a foreign race, she used her influence to save her people. Women of every age and walk of life will discover how to— As women are obedient to God's leading, they will find strength and inner beauty flowing through them as they positively affect the lives of those around them.

160 pages, Paperback

First published January 1, 2001

Another great Bible study by Goerge. I loved how she brought in the proverbs and sections of the old testament to shine a light on Esther's character.
Two interesting facts I learned that were not in this book but because my friend Kelsey and I did some extra research.
The reach of the Persia-Media empire was huge. If the degree to kill the Jews had gone forth, it would have effectively wiped out all of them.
Some scholars think the book of Esther was the official court record that Mordecai had made. To preserve the true story, he refrained from mentioning God. So, the story would be preserved in the royal archives.

If you have wanted to do Bible study but felt you didn't have time to do justice to the study. Ms George does a wonderful job at putting this study of Esther into segments that can be studied in about 15 minutes. She writes the reviews and adds questions that you can answer includes the actual scripture from the Bible so that way if you want to take this devotional with you on a bus ride or whatever you wouldn't have to take your Bible too (if you didn't want to). In this devotional she also includes additional scripture you can look up in your Bible to continue with the lesson being learnt. Very nice read-devotional.
